    Shantz, Stanley, son of Addison and Priscella (Devitt) Shantz, was born in Guernsey, Sask., May 23, 1914; died at the K-W Hospital, Kitchener, Ont., Mar. 1, 1990; aged 75. He was married to Fern Burkhart, who died in 1979. On Apr. 6, 1985, he was married to Kathryn Yoder, who survives. Also surviving are 3 sons (Calvin, Nelson, and Melvin), one daughter (Elinor Gingerich), 6 grandchildren, and 2 brothers (Arnold and Lyle). He was ordained to the ministry and served the following congregations: Sharon, Holyrood, Baden-Geiger, and First Mennonite in Vineland. He also served as interim pastor for a number of congregations. He was a member of Wilmot Mennonite Church, where funeral services were held on Mar. 3, in charge of Jean Goulet; spring interment in the church cemetery.

    Shantz, Addison Cressman, son of Amos M. and Esther (Cressman) Shantz, was born Aug. 22, 1878; passed away at Watrous, Sask., April 15, 1958; aged 79 y. 7 m. 24 d. He moved to Manitoba as a young man and took up farming. In 1912, he was united in marriage to Priscilla Devitt of Kitchener, Ont. As a young man he was baptized into the fellowship of the Methodist Church, later transferring his membership to the United Church. He took an active interest in the welfare of the Mennonite Church in his community. He is survived by his wife, 3 sons, 8 grandchildren, and 5 sisters (Mrs. Urias Snider, Kitchener, Ont.; Mrs. Herb Shantz, Waterloo, Ont.; Magdalina, Barbara, and Elminda Shantz, Kitchener, Ont.). An infant sister (Sylvia) and 4 brothers (Josiah, Jeremiah, Jonathan, and Samuel) preceded him in death. Funeral services were held at the United Church, Watrous, Sask., April 18, in charge of the local pastor and at the Sharon Mennonite Church in charge of J. B. Stauffer and Paul Schroeder. Burial in the adjoining cemetery.

    BURKHART - Clarence Leslie He was born at Elmira, Ont., March 16, 1895, the son of the late Enoch and Hannah (Eby) Burkhart; died of leukemia at the family home near Guernsey, Sask., Sept. 28, 1952; aged 57 y. 6 m. 12 d. He came to Saskatchewan in 1917 and started farming in the Guernsey district. On Feb. 18, 1920, he was united in marriage to Mary Ann Snider, who survives. Also surviving are 9 children (Fern-Mrs. Stanley Shantz, Greta-Mrs. Ralph Hawes, Florence, Kenneth, Merle, Mary, Ray, Beatrice, and Berna), 3 grandchildren, 2 sisters (Mrs. Abner Musselman, Elmira, Ont.; and Mrs. Mervin Shantz, Alma, Ont.), and 4 brothers (Lloyd, Emerson, and Gordon, Kitchener, Ont.; and Irvin, Goshen, Ind.) One son (Stanley) preceded him in death in infancy. He took and active interest in many local affairs and will be greatly missed by the community. Funeral services was held Oct. 2 at the Sharon Mennonite Church, Guernsey, Sask., of which he was a member. The services were in charge of J.B. Stauffer of Tofield, Alta., assisted by Howard Snider and Paul Schroeder. Burial was made in the adjoining cemetery.

    Snider. --- Lydia Jane, daughter of Mr. and Mrs. Moses Clemens was born Jan. 22, 1860; died May 5, 1950; aged 90 y. 3 m. 13 d. Her death, which followed a lingering illness which she bore very patiently, occurred at the home of her daughter (Mrs. Weston Bowman), near Kitchener, Ont., where she had made her home the last years. On March 9, 1879, she was married to Joshua Snider, of Elmira, Ont., who predeceased her. Surviving are 11 children (Emmanuel, Blackie, Alta.; Abraham, Guernsey, Sask.; Clayton, West Montrose, Ont.; Clemens, Guernsey, Sask.; Cyrenius, Kitchener, Ont.; Emma-Mrs. Edwin Snider, Waterloo, Ont.; Lydia Ann-Mrs. Ira Gingrich, Guernsey, Sask.; Elizabeth-Mrs. Weston Bowman, Centreville, Ont.; Mary-Mrs. Clarence Burkhardt, Guernsey, Sask.; Minerva, Stratford, Ont.; Angeline-Mrs. William Sommers, West Montrose, Ont.). She united with the Mennonite Church in her youth and remained a faithful member until death. She was a kind and loving mother. Most of her life was spent on a farm near West Montrose, Ont. Funeral services were held May 7 at the Elmira Mennonite Church. Burial was made in the adjoining cemetery. Oliver D. Snider and Howard S. Bauman officiated.
